Abstract:Phase-shift photoelastic method is a digital photoelastic measurement technique. Ten-step phase-shift method has been widely used in the phase-shift photoelastic method because of its high measurement accuracy. However, the ten-step phase shift method needs to collect 10 phase shift images in the measurement process, and needs to manually rotate the lens and switch the light source in the process of sampling, which is complicated and has low measurement efficiency. In order to solve this problem, an automatic phase shift photoelastic measurement system based on a polarization camera was proposed. The system applied the polarization camera to acquire images, used the combination of white light and filters as the light source, and controlled the lens rotation and light source switching through the electronic control system, so as to realize the automatic and efficient acquisition of phase shift images. Experimental measurements on a disk and a ring demonstrate that the proposed system can complete the acquisition of 10 phase-shift images within 5 s, which effectively improves the measurement efficiency compared with the traditional measurement system. In addition, the experimental results also prove the accuracy of the system measurement.
